Jikalau asing, mungkin bisa dipelajari. Namun apabila sudah merambah ke yang namanya ‘berat’, ‘lemot’ dan tidak kompatibel dengan perangkat, bisa jadi adalah temuan masalah tersendiri. Tidak cukup sampai disitu, terkadang ada embel-embel software ‘berbayar’ juga menjadi salah satu hal menjengkelkan yang kesekian untuk para developer.
Namun tenang saja, karena masih banyak sekali game engine gratis yang dapat digunakan untuk alternatif pembuatan game digital untuk kalian.
Berikut ini adalah game engine gratis untuk pemula yang dapat kalian gunakan untuk game development.
Namun sebelum itu, kalian harus memahami bahwa setiap game engine gratis akan memiliki masing-masing kekuatan dan kelemahan untuk proyek-proyek tertentu. Juga, masing-masing engine ini memiliki gaya dan pengguna tersendiri yang berbeda satu sama lain.
Seperti contohnya, Construct 2 yang memang ditujukan untuk pemula dan non-programmer, sedangkan Unreal Engine pada awalnya dibuat untuk game FPS profesional dengan keunggulan grafis menakjubkan. Kalian juga dapat membandingkannya dengan melihat game engine apa saja yang biasa digunakan oleh teman-teman kalian, dan manakah yang paling menonjol.
Sungguh, jika kalian semakin sering menggunakan, maka akan semakin meningkat pula kemampuan pengembangan game yang kalian kuasai.
GODOT
Godot menjadi salah satu solusi game engine gratis kalian untuk pengembangan game cross-platform maksimal. Ini adalah salah satu game engine paling populer untuk pengembangan game 2D dan juga dapat bekerja dengan 3D. Versi Godot 3.0 membawa pembaruan besar ke fitur 3D, dan dapat membawanya ke barisan dengan kecepatan maksimal dibandingkan dengan game engine modern lainnya, sambil tetap memberikan penggunanya fasilitas gratis.
Godot juga menawarkan 2D machine khusus yang bekerja dalam koordinat piksel dan membuat aktivitas pengembangan game 2D menjadi mudah. Dengan berbagai bahasa yang tersedia termasuk C ++, C #, dan GDScript (varian python), Godot mudah diprogram dan mudah dipelajari.
Bagian terbaik dari Godot adalah sistem scene dan sistem node. Ini membuat pengorganisasian game kalian akan mudah, dan juga lebih mempercepat pengembangan dan meningkatkan skalabilitas proyek yang sedang dikerjakan. Dengan tools animasi yang kuat dan editor skrip bawaan, jika kalian membuat game dengan Godot, akan mendapati pengembangan yang menyenangkan. Ini adalah game engine yang patut dicoba, terutama jika kalian menyukai proyek 2D.
DEFOLD
Mencari game engine 2D gratis? Nah Defold mengemas semua yang kamu butuhkan untuk pengembangan menjadi satu tool. Software ini dipasarkan sebagai cara terbaik untuk membuat game para desainer web dan seluler. Disini kalian akan dibekali dengan kontrol versi bawaan dan fitur manajemen tim.
Dengan berfokus pada pengembangan game 2D, Defold dapat memberikan paket yang efisien dengan tools yang diarahkan khusus ke dunia 2D. Saat memulainya, kalian dapat dengan mudah menggunakan banyak tutorial rinci yang disediakan di editor, segera setelah instalasi.
Walaupun dapat memakan waktu beberapa jam, tetapi kalian akan dapat mempelajari semua dasar-dasar bagaimana cara membangun platformer dari awal, atau membuat efek paralaks pada background, atau apa pun yang kamu inginkan!
Defold menggunakan bahasa pemrograman Lua untuk scripting. Ini juga game engine gratis dan open source, sesuai dengan tujuannya yang memang ingin memberikan pengalaman pengembangan yang ringan dan gratis.
CONSTRUCT
situs : constructs.netConstruct dapat juga disebut sebagai mesin kecil yang cukup kuat yang dirancang khusus untuk game HTML5 berbasis 2D. Sedikit mirip dengan Flowlab, Construct 2 menggunakan antarmuka drag-and-drop WYSIWYG untuk pembuatan game.
Muncul dengan banyak plug-in, efek visual, dan sumber daya lainnya sehingga kalian dapat mulai membuat game langsung dari kotak, dan jujur, pembuatan judul platformer sederhana mungkin memakan waktu 2 jam, jika kalian sebelumnya sudah memiliki semua sumber daya yang telah siap.
Construct 2 menawarkan trial game engine gratis, dan jika kalian suka, kalian dapat membeli lisensi berjenjang meskipun tingkatan tersebut mungkin tampak sedikit membingungkan, karena begitu banyak yang ditawarkan di halaman toko mereka. Tetapi intinya adalah kalian tidak diizinkan untuk mendapatkan penghasilan dari lisensi gratis.
CORONA
Ramah pemula dan menyenangkan untuk dipelajari, Corona benar-benar merupakan game engine gratis yang tanpa embel-embel biaya tersembunyi. Itu tentunya akan sangat menyenangkan, mengingat begitu banyak mesin game memang membutuhkan pembayaran untuk produk komersial.
Jika kalian ingin belajar tetapi tidak yakin harus mulai dari mana, dapatkan bantuan dari komunitas Corona yang terdiri lebih dari setengah juta pengembang lain. Mereka juga memiliki subreddit kecil namun bermanfaat yang dapat kalian telusuri.
Dalam banyak hal Corona lebih dari sekadar mesin permainan. Mereka menggabungkan pasar pengguna dengan layanan penerbitan dan mesin game yang semuanya digabung menjadi satu. Dengan berdasar bahwa pengembang dapat lebih fokus pada pembuatan game dan mengurangi kerumitan dalam mempromosikan dan menjual karya mereka.
Ditujukan untuk pemula dan pengembang seluler yang mencari game engine gratis, Corona menawarkan proses yang lebih linier dan lebih mudah dipelajari daripada yang dibutuhkan oleh IDE yang lebih besar. Mereka yang mencari jalan resistensi paling sedikit harus mempertimbangkan Corona, setidaknya jika kalian termasuk baru dalam dunia game dev.
UNITY
situs : unity.comNah, yang satu ini adalah favorit ane. Karena disamping ini game engine gratis, juga kelengkapannya yang ting ting.
Jika kalian sedang mencari game engine yang menyediakan satu tempat untuk semua hal, Unity adalah salah satu software yang harus kalian coba. Disini, kalian akan menemui seperangkat tools yang spesifik tetapi dapat diakses dengan mudah, dan ini pulalah yang telah menjadikan Unity menjadi game engine paling populer.
Karena toolset lintas-platform yang mumpuni, Unity telah digunakan untuk membuat game-game hit seperti Pokemon Go, Hearthstone, dan Rimworld. Mungkin bagian terbaik dari Unity adalah komunitasnya yang sudah besar dan sekaligus menyediakan persediaan aset baru dan sumber belajar yang tidak terbatas.
Jika kamu memiliki waktu dan pengabdian untuk belajar Unity, masuklah kedalam komunitas, dan kamu akan mendapatkan pengalaman, sekaligus aset game gratis yang dapat langsung digunakan.
Berkat kemitraan dengan Microsoft, pengembang Unity juga memiliki opsi untuk menggunakan
Visual Studio sebagai editor skrip. Visual Studio menyediakan alat yang memfasilitasi penggunanya untuk melakukan peningkatan besar dibandingkan pengalaman asli Unity dan ini berguna jika kalian biasanya melakukan coding di MS Visual Studio.
Perhatikan bahwa sebenarnya Unity tidak 100% game engine yang gratis jika kalian ingin menghasilkan uang dari game yang telah dibuat. Karena kalian juga pasti akan ngiler dengan beragam plugin yang dapat dibeli di store mereka.
UNREAL
situs : unrealengine.comIni bisa dibilang dewa nya game engine gratis. Bagaimana tidak, karena ane mau tidak mau harus mengatakan bahwa Unreal Engine 4 benar-benar dedengkotnya game engine gratis.
Bahkan tahukah kalian, bahwa game besar Fortnite, GTA V, Player Unknown Battlegrounds, dan bahkan pilihan terakhir untuk Kingdom Hearts 3, Unreal Engine menawarkan semua yang kalian butuhkan untuk membuat game berkualitas tinggi yang memukau seperti barisan game tersebut.
Untuk merancang game AAA sungguhan, kalian mungkin memang membutuhkan tim yang besar. Tapi itu tidak berarti bahwa sebuah studio indie kecil tidak dapat masuk dan mulai mengerjakan sesuatu menggunakan ini. Kemampuan grafis Unreal menyaingi CryEngine, tetapi Unreal lebih halus dan ramah pengguna.
Scripting ditangani dalam C ++ sehingga kalian dapat mengambil manfaat dari beberapa latar belakang pemrograman. Tetapi dengan Blueprints, editor skrip berbasis node, pengembang Unreal dapat membuat behavior(perilaku) karakter tanpa menulis satu baris kode.
Epic telah menyediakan berbagai tutorial untuk membantu pemula merasa nyaman dengan Unreal, mereka juga menawarkan dukungan lintas platform untuk game 2D dan 3D. Seperti Unity, Unreal memiliki pasar aset sendiri di mana pengguna dapat menemukan model dan alat untuk digunakan dalam engine mereka sendiri.
Meskipun fitur konten berkualitas, pasar Unreal tidak sekuat toko aset Unity. Tapi jangan biarkan itu menghalangi kamu untuk mencobanya!.
Uniknya, jika kalian memutuskan untuk memilih Unreal, maka tidak menutup kemungkinan kalian akan terbiasa untuk kemudian menggunakan game engine lain.
CRYENGINE
CryEngine adalah game engine gratis 3D tangguh yang ditujukan untuk menghadirkan grafis canggih untuk konsol atau PC. Dengan dukungan VR yang solid dan efek visual canggih, CryEngine tentunya sangat menarik bagi pengembang yang ingin membuat game fotorealistik atau game modern pada platform seperti Steam.
Secara umum, game engine gratis satu ini bertujuan untuk konten berkualitas AAA dengan karakter yang sangat detail & super realistis. Seperti Unity dan Unreal 4, CryEngine menawarkan serangkaian alat untuk membuat pengembangan game lebih mudah.
Ini jelas layak untuk digunakan jika kalian serius tentang game development tingkat tinggi.
Sayangnya, CryEngine memiliki reputasi yang kurang tinggi karena sulit digunakan dan lebih sulit dipelajari daripada kebanyakan engine lain. Para pemula sayangnya harus tetap mempelajari game engine lain terlebih dahulu, untuk kemudian menggunakan CryEngine sebagai piliha berikutnya.
Bagaimana? Tertarik untuk menggunakan salah satu game engine gratis di atas?. Namun kalian juga patut mencatat bahwa walaupun semua game engine ini benar-benar gratis untuk digunakan, tetapi ketika menerbitkan game komersial yang memiki royalti, setidaknya kalian harus mempertimbangkan kembali untuk membeli ataupun memberikan sedikit royalty kepada para pengembangnya.